Impactful filming in the city and road closures
If your filming will have an impact on the city such as road closures, we will need more notice than three working days.
If your filming requires a road closure, then we will need at least 12 weeks notice for the application to be processed. Filming in the sea
For any filming that involves people swimming or entering the sea, we will need a minimum of 10 working days. You will need to do a risk assessment and arrange any additional safety measures such as a life boat.

Filming on other council-owned land
Filming on some council land requires other departments to be involved. This includes filming in car parks, council buildings or housing land. In such instances, we will need a longer period of notice.
Filming with a drone in Brighton & Hove
If you want to use a drone as part of your filming, then please submit these documents with your completed application form:
- drone operators CAA licence
- drone operators Insurance
- drone operators risk assessment
- flight map showing where the drone will take off and land, as well as where it will be flown
